What to Know About Sóndor
Key Facts
Sóndor is a district located in the Huancabamba Province of the Piura Region in northwestern Peru. Situated in the highlands of the Andes mountains, this district occupies an elevated position within its parent province, characterized by rugged terrain and significant altitude variations. Sóndor covers an approximate area of 250 square kilometers and has a population of around 3,000 residents, primarily engaged in agricultural activities and small-scale farming. The district is administratively divided into several smaller populated centers and rural communities that dot its mountainous landscape. Its climate varies with elevation, ranging from temperate in the lower valleys to cooler conditions at higher altitudes, supporting diverse agricultural production including potatoes, corn, and various Andean grains. The district's infrastructure includes basic educational facilities, health posts, and transportation networks connecting it to the provincial capital of Huancabamba.
